What is MSDS Form

The Material Safety Data Sheet is a business document used by employers to communicate hazardous material information and ensure workplace safety.

The preparation of a Material Safety Data Sheet is typically required for businesses that handle hazardous materials to comply with OSHA regulations. Employers directly involved in the handling, manufacturing, or storage of such substances must prepare this form.
Essential information includes the manufacturer’s details, types of hazardous materials, health hazard descriptions, and emergency procedures. It's critical to gather accurate data related to the chemicals involved.
After completing the MSDS, you can submit it by following your organization's procedures. Options may include printing it for physical submission or submitting it electronically, depending on the protocols in place.
Common mistakes include leaving required fields blank, using outdated contact information, or failing to include all hazardous material details. Ensure every section is checked thoroughly before finalizing the form.
While there may not be specific submission deadlines, it's essential to update the MSDS whenever new hazardous materials are introduced or if the current data changes, to remain compliant with safety regulations.
No, notarization is not required for the Material Safety Data Sheet. It is primarily an internal document for workplace safety compliance.
Failure to complete the MSDS correctly can lead to health risks, regulatory fines, and liability issues in the event of an accident involving hazardous materials. Always prioritize accuracy and compliance.
